Target Group is seeking a DevOps Software Engineer in Cardiff, Wales, to design and build secure cloud-native platforms using AWS technologies. The role requires expertise in AWS cloud services, Infrastructure as Code, and CI/CD pipelines.
Key responsibilities include:
- Automating delivery processes
- Maintaining cloud networking
The position offers a competitive salary of up to £45,000, hybrid working, and various benefits such as a pension scheme and private medical insurance.

How to prepare for a job interview at Target Group
✨Know Your AWS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your AWS knowledge before the interview. Familiarise yourself with the latest services and features, especially those related to security and automation. Being able to discuss specific AWS tools you've used will show your expertise and passion for the role.
✨Showcase Your Infrastructure as Code Skills
Prepare to talk about your experience with Infrastructure as Code (IaC). Bring examples of projects where you've implemented IaC, and be ready to explain the benefits it brought to the team. This will demonstrate your practical skills and understanding of modern DevOps practices.
✨Highlight Your CI/CD Experience
CI/CD is a big part of this role, so be prepared to discuss your experience with continuous integration and delivery pipelines. Share specific tools you've used, any challenges you faced, and how you overcame them. This will help illustrate your problem-solving abilities and technical know-how.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team's current projects, their approach to cloud security, or how they handle automation challenges.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if the company is the right fit for you.
